The Nokia 8850: A Blast from the Past

Released in 1999, the Nokia 8850 was one of the most popular feature phones of its time. This slim and stylish device, weighing only 91g with a thickness of 17mm, was the perfect combination of functionality and fashion. Dimensions and Network The Nokia 8850 may not have been the smallest phone on the market, but its compact size was convenient for users on the go. With its GSM technology, it could support two networks, GSM 900 and 1800, providing users with reliable call quality. Display and Memory The monochrome graphic display of the Nokia 8850 was ahead of its time with its dynamic font size and availability of five lines for messaging. This feature allowed for better readability and a more user-friendly experience. This device also had no card slot but made up for it with 250 phonebook entries and memory for 8 voice dial numbers and 50 calendar notes. Camera and Sound Although the Nokia 8850 may not have had a camera, it offered users the option to download monophonic ringtones and had space for five received ringing tones. Unfortunately, it did not have a loudspeaker or a 3.5mm jack, but the vibration alert kept users notified of incoming calls. Features and Battery Life Despite its lack of Bluetooth, WLAN, positioning, and radio, the Nokia 8850 had much to offer in terms of features. It supported SMS messaging and came with three pre-installed games. Users were also given the option to choose from 32 different languages and take advantage of the predictive text input and smart messaging capabilities. The device's battery life was impressive, with a removable Li-Ion 830 mAh battery that could last between 50 to 150 hours on standby and 2 to 3 hours and 20 minutes of talk time.
